An opinionated, zero-config status line and history picker for fish, bash and zsh, written in Zig.
Two things, not one. whetuu draws the status line above your cursor, and it puts your history on the up arrow by default.
Both live in one binary, so the picker knows where you are. Its configured key opens on what you ran in this directory, and a second configured key switches to all of it. Failed commands are never stored, so you do not scroll past your own typos.
Your own shell history stays exactly where it is. whetuu never reads or rewrites it, and keeps its own store alongside. See History for what the picker does and where it keeps things.

The history key accepts "up", "ctrl-up", "alt-up", or "ctrl-" plus any
letter except C, D, H, I, J or M, whose control characters already edit,
confirm or cancel the picker. Up is the default. Setting it to Ctrl+Up or
Alt+Up leaves the plain up arrow to the shell, which makes multiline editing
work normally; a Ctrl+letter binding leaves it alone too. Press the configured
key again to cancel the open picker. Open a new shell after changing it. Unix
terminals do not have a portable Command key sequence. To use Command+Up,
configure the terminal to send one of the supported modified Up sequences.
The history scope_key switches between this directory and all history. It
defaults to "ctrl-g" and accepts "ctrl-" plus any letter except C, D, H, I,
J or M, whose control characters already edit, confirm or cancel the picker.
key and scope_key must use different letters.

A status line runs before every command, so you pay its cost constantly.
Numbers from hyperfine --warmup 40 --runs 400 on a 13th gen i9-13900H,
ReleaseFast build, with the toolchain version cache warm, pinned to the
performance cores on an otherwise idle machine:
| Directory | Render | For comparison |
|---|---|---|
| No repo, no toolchain | 2.3 ms ± 0.7 | — |
| Zig repo, 35 files | 3.0 ms ± 0.9 | zig version alone: 3.1 ms |
| Monorepo, 8259 files | 20.2 ms ± 2.5 | git status alone: 19.3 ms |
Two things do most of the work. The probes overlap, so a render costs about what
the slowest one costs rather than the sum of all of them. In the monorepo the
whole status line takes about as long as git status on its own.
Toolchain versions are also cached, keyed on the binary path, mtime and size.
The first render in a project pays for the probe. Later ones read a small file
instead. Upgrading a toolchain changes its mtime, which drops the stale entry.
What that saves depends on the toolchain. A slow --version call is well worth
skipping. A fast one is already hidden behind the git probe running alongside
it, which is why the Zig repo above lands within noise of zig version itself.

A slow repository cannot hang your shell. Both subprocesses are bounded. The
git call gets 250 ms and the toolchain probe gets 200 ms. They run at the same
time, so the worst case is the larger of the two, not the sum. Given a git
that hangs for 30 s, the status line still returns in 257 ms. It simply drops
the git segment.
In a large repository, almost all of that time is git status, and most of that
is the scan for untracked files. Speeding it up is git's job, not whetuu's.
Turning on git's untracked cache cut git status from 13.5 ms to 5.7 ms on a
test repository of 8000 files:

One thing to know. When enabled, the language module picks which toolchain to
probe from the files in the current directory. So entering an untrusted
repository can make whetuu run something like node --version. It runs the
binary your PATH resolves, never one from the repository. If you keep . in
your PATH that distinction goes away, and it goes away for every other tool
you run too. Set language = false to disable the scan and probe.

The macOS binaries are unsigned. Download one in a browser and Gatekeeper
quarantines it, so the first run fails with "cannot be opened because the
developer cannot be verified". Clear the flag once with
xattr -d com.apple.quarantine "$(command -v whetuu)". Downloading with curl
or wget avoids the attribute entirely.

whetuu keeps its own command history. It is one file, shared by all three
shells, at ~/.local/share/whetuu/history. It moves under $XDG_DATA_HOME when
that variable is set. macOS uses the same path rather than ~/Library, so the
store stays put when you share a dotfiles setup across machines.
Nothing is ever deleted from it. The picker reads the most recent few megabytes rather than the whole file, so it opens just as fast on a store built over years as on a fresh one. Everything you have run stays on disk either way, and on a store that large the commands past the window are ones you last ran years ago.
Your shell's own history file is untouched. whetuu never reads, writes or
truncates ~/.bash_history, ~/.zsh_history or fish's database. The two stores
run side by side. Delete the whetuu store and your shell history is exactly as
it was.
Two things it does take by default. The up arrow opens the picker. On bash only,
ignorespace is added to your HISTCONTROL, keeping whatever value you already
had, so a space prefixed command stays out of both stores. Set the picker to
Ctrl+Up or Alt+Up to leave the up arrow alone. Ctrl+R and every other shell
binding keep working.
A command is recorded once it finishes, and only when it exited with status 0. Typos and failed runs never enter the store. Prefix a command with a space to keep it out of the store entirely. Every command is stored together with the directory it ran in.
The command that just broke is not lost. When a command does not exit 0, it appears at the top of the picker, in red. Pick it to fix and run it again. Cancel and it is still there the next time you open the picker. It lives in memory until you run another command, and never reaches the store.

The list grows upward from the bottom. The most recent command sits just above
the search line and older ones climb from there. Each row is prefixed with how
long ago it ran, like 5m, 2h or 3d. The selected row is highlighted across
the full width in the star purple of the status line.
Commands are syntax highlighted. The program name, flags, paths, variables, quoted strings and operators each get their own color, so a long row reads at a glance. The colors come from your terminal theme rather than from whetuu, so the picker matches the palette you already run. The selected row switches to lighter tints of the same colors, which stay readable on the purple.
Paths are recognized by how they are written, like /tmp/out, ./build or
~/dev. A bare src stays plain. whetuu never touches the filesystem to render
a row, so it cannot know that one is a directory.
A command wider than the terminal loses its middle to a … rather than its end.
Both the program name and the tail stay on screen. That is what keeps a run of
commands sharing one long prefix apart, like several cd <long path> && git …
entries that differ only in the part a plain cut would drop.
Rows are drawn on one line. Runs of spaces, tabs and newlines each collapse to a single space, so a command written across several lines stays readable in the list. This changes the row only. Enter and Tab both give you back the command exactly as it was recorded.
The picker draws on /dev/tty, so nothing but the chosen command reaches
stdout. Duplicates are collapsed per directory, so the same command run in two
projects keeps its own recency in each.
